Anambra State Governor, Charles Chukwuma Soludo, has expressed his administration’s vision to transform the state into Nigeria’s new investment hub. Speaking at a recent event, Soludo highlighted the strategic economic initiatives and reforms being implemented to attract local and international investors to the state.
According to Soludo, Anambra is poised to become a key player in Nigeria’s economic growth due to its strategic location, robust infrastructure, and the state government’s commitment to fostering a business-friendly environment. He emphasized that the state offers unique opportunities in sectors such as manufacturing, technology, agriculture, and renewable energy, and that Anambra is focused on creating a conducive atmosphere for businesses to thrive.
“We are building Anambra into a state that is open for business,” Soludo said. He outlined various projects aimed at improving infrastructure, easing regulatory processes, and providing incentives for investors. Key among these initiatives is the establishment of industrial parks, development of smart cities, and the ongoing efforts to enhance the state’s power supply and transportation networks.
The Governor also noted that Anambra’s private sector-led growth strategy would help address the challenges of unemployment and youth empowerment, contributing to the state’s socio-economic development. Soludo pointed out that the state government is working closely with both local and international partners to ensure that investments are maximized, and that Anambra’s business ecosystem remains competitive on a global scale.
Soludo’s remarks were welcomed by business leaders and entrepreneurs, who see the potential for Anambra to emerge as a major economic force in the South-East and beyond. With its growing industrial base and fertile business environment, the state is already attracting attention from both Nigerian and foreign investors looking for new opportunities in the region.
Anambra’s push to become Nigeria’s investment hub is part of Soludo’s broader vision to modernize the state’s economy and create sustainable development opportunities for its residents. If successful, this initiative could position Anambra as a leading state in Nigeria’s investment landscape, further contributing to the country’s economic diversification efforts.
